在数字化时代,网站已经成为展示个人、企业或组织形象的重要平台。而前端技术作为网站构建的核心,其重要性不言而喻。本文将带领你从基础到实战,全面掌握网站构建之道,让你成为破解前端矩阵的高手。
前端技术概述
1. HTML:网页骨架
HTML(HyperText Markup Language)是构建网页的基本语言,它定义了网页的结构和内容。了解HTML的基本标签,如<div>、<span>、<h1>、<p>等,是学习前端技术的第一步。
2. CSS:网页样式
CSS(Cascading Style Sheets)用于设置网页的样式,如颜色、字体、布局等。学习CSS,你需要掌握选择器、盒子模型、布局技巧等。
3. JavaScript:网页交互
JavaScript是一种客户端脚本语言,用于实现网页的动态效果和交互功能。学习JavaScript,你需要掌握变量、数据类型、函数、事件处理等。
前端框架与库
1. Bootstrap
Bootstrap是一个流行的前端框架,它提供了丰富的组件和样式,可以帮助你快速搭建响应式网页。
2. Vue.js
Vue.js是一个渐进式JavaScript框架,它允许你用简洁的语法构建用户界面。Vue.js的核心思想是组件化,这使得开发大型项目更加容易。
3. React
React是由Facebook开发的一个JavaScript库,用于构建用户界面。React的核心思想是虚拟DOM,它可以提高网页的渲染性能。
前端工程化
1. Gulp
Gulp是一个自动化构建工具,可以帮助你自动化前端项目的任务,如编译、压缩、合并等。
2. Webpack
Webpack是一个现代JavaScript应用模块打包工具,它可以将多个JavaScript文件打包成一个或多个bundle。
3. Babel
Babel是一个JavaScript编译器,它可以将ES6+代码转换为浏览器兼容的代码。
实战项目
1. 个人博客
通过搭建个人博客,你可以学习到HTML、CSS、JavaScript、Vue.js等技术的综合应用。
2. 在线商城
通过开发在线商城,你可以学习到前后端分离、接口设计、数据库操作等技能。
3. 移动端应用
通过开发移动端应用,你可以学习到响应式设计、移动端适配等技术。
总结
前端技术是网站构建的核心,掌握前端技术对于成为一名优秀的开发者至关重要。通过本文的介绍,相信你已经对前端技术有了更深入的了解。接下来,你需要付出实践,不断积累经验,才能在破解前端矩阵的道路上越走越远。
